Literacy Mentoring
Literacy Mentoring involves volunteers going into schools once a week to provide children with additional reading support, mainly in primary schools.
Literacy mentors work with two children for an academic term. All volunteers receive a day's free training from BEST, plus ongoing support, monitoring and evaluation.
Benefits:
- Improving children's reading ages
- Improving self-confidence, motivation and interest in school work
- Experience of working with a positive role model from the world of work
- Improving links between organisations and the local community
- Influencing the ambitions and aspirations of the future workforce
- Promoting the personal development of employees
- Increasing understanding of initiatives taking place in schools
- Fulfilling Corporate Social Responsibility (CSR) policies
